An Advanced Certificate in Genomic Variants in Pernicious Anemia is increasingly significant in today's UK healthcare market. Pernicious anemia, an autoimmune disease affecting vitamin B12 absorption, impacts a substantial portion of the population. While precise UK-wide prevalence data is limited, studies suggest a rate of approximately 1 in 1000, with higher incidence in older adults. Understanding the genomic variations linked to this condition is crucial for improved diagnosis, personalized treatment strategies, and ultimately, better patient outcomes.

This certificate equips healthcare professionals with the advanced knowledge and skills needed to interpret complex genomic data, contributing to a more precise and efficient approach to managing pernicious anemia.
